The 3 months correlation between Prospect and Consumer is -0.49. Overlapping area represents the amount of risk that can be diversified away by holding Prospect Capital and Consumer Portfolio Services in the same portfolio, assuming nothing else is changed. The correlation between historical prices or returns on Consumer Portfolio and Prospect Capital is a relative statistical measure of the degree to which these equity instruments tend to move together. The correlation coefficient measures the extent to which returns on Prospect Capital are associated (or correlated) with Consumer Portfolio. Values of the correlation coefficient range from -1 to +1, where. The correlation of zero (0) is possible when the price movement of Consumer Portfolio has no effect on the direction of Prospect Capital i.e., Prospect Capital and Consumer Portfolio go up and down completely randomly.

The main advantage of trading using opposite Prospect Capital and Consumer Portfolio posit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Prospect Capital position performs unexpectedly, Consumer Portfolio can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
